Output e8aba55a56e27b18f64e1fadbd9a0addf65eec9e9e30fe34f165441712672f0e:5

value
36803201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9489902968153a5c9006fcf2a9078ff9a6bfc811 OP_EQUAL
address
MMSZ2shvuKcSiajHpyhCp7LszjoZ1Mopea
transaction
e8aba55a56e27b18f64e1fadbd9a0addf65eec9e9e30fe34f165441712672f0e
spent
true